I have nine casements, there are two types of actuators, two smaller singles and seven of the dual actuated types. The actuators are in decent shape, no gear problems? but I want to convert the fixed internal handles to foldable to get the handles out of the way of my blinds. Can you tell me from the pictures if I can convert this type of actuator to a folding crank like the Encore Tango or similar? So far I have not found a way to take the internal cover off.
If not, what would I need to do to get a folding option? Please don't say buy new actuators, that feels like such a waste.

Hello, Take a look at the video below that will help you choose the correct Encore operators to replace your dual arm assemblies. As for the second split arm operator, take a look and compare the specifications of the 39-220B and 39-221B to yours. I believe that your original operators are the Maxim style that does not have removable covers but would be compatible with the 39-205 folding handle. The new style Encore replacements use the 39-375 and 39-376 folding handle and cover kits. Thanks for posting! |
